Subway Supervisor

The supervisor is required to regularly and customarily exercise discretion in managing the overall operation of the store as the deputy to the Store Manager. The supervisor is responsible for serving customers, following health and safety procedures and keeping the store clean. You will assist in the development and training of Sandwich Artists and ensuring customer satisfaction and team productivity.
The Supervisor is responsible for demonstrating the principles in accordance with the franchise company and the Subway brand.
This role assists the Store Manager by creating and maintaining the Subway experience for our customers and partners.
Key Responsibilities Include:
Leadership.
Managing with integrity, honesty and knowledge to promote the culture, values and mission.
Providing coaching and guidance to the store team towards ensuring operational goals are achieved.
Managing operations & measuring results.
Communicating clearly, concisely, accurately and professionally at all times.
Constantly monitoring and managing store staffing levels to ensure sales are driven forward and maximised, and to ensure partner development and talent.
Maintaining efficient ordering methods to ensure availability of required menu items and a proper balance of goods in inventory.
Regularly inspecting equipment and fixtures, inside and outside the store to ensure they are in proper working order and good condition.
Executing functional responsibilities.
Utilising management information tools and analysing paperwork as requested to identify and address trends and issues in store performance.
Using all operational tools to plan for and achieve operational excellence in the store.
Responsible for adherence to Subway brand compliance standards with focus on standards relating to food safety.
Team member development/team building.
Providing staff with coaching, feedback and development opportunities to build effective teams by:
Challenging and inspiring staff members to achieve business results.
Ensuring staff members adhere to all established Subway operational standards.
Developing and maintaining positive relationships with the store team.
Utilising and demonstrating effective management policies and procedures.
Duties:
Maintaining business records as outlined in the Operations Manual and analysing business records to manage the business.
Communicating changes of food preparations formulas, standards, etc. to staff.
Supporting local and national marketing initiatives.
Ensuring that all local and national health and food safety codes are maintained, and that company safety and security policies are followed.
